This gas liquefaction process, pioneered by Raoul Pictet, liquefies a gas by using a series of other gases with progressively lower boiling points. The first gas is liquefied by 압력 at ambient temperature. Its evaporation is then used to cool and liquefy a second, more volatile gas, which in turn is used to cool and liquefy the target gas, creating a ‘cascade’ of cooling stages.
